Reduce Debt with Bargain Shopping




Shopping is a part of life and some of us enjoy it a lot more than others. A portion of debt includes discretionary items that could have been purchased for much less had you just waited or done some research.


Bargain shopping not only saves you money but it can reduce your overall debt. Become a savvy shopper and look for bargains, special deals and discounts. The Internet has made it so easy to find discounts and coupons for just about anything. TLC has a show entitled Extreme Couponing. It's incredible the amount of money consumers engaged in "extreme couponing" can save.


Build wealth with bargain shopping

Creditcards.com recently released a survey that showed nearly half of all affluent people would not spend more than $100 on any gift they buy the holiday season.


Rich people like Walmart, Target and Costco according according to a survey of 1200 affluent investors by financial site Millionaire Corner. About 1 in four worth $5 million or more shop at these stores.


Do some research

Take the time and do a little research before you make a purchase. Almost everything you purchase can be purchased at a discount. A good place to begin your research is the newspaper and that annoying junk mail that fills your mailbox. Some of it has real value and great savings.


Deals Online

Great deals and coupons can always be found online. Online deals can be found at websites such as Groupon, Retailmenot, DealsofAmerica and AbleShoppers.


DealsofAmerica lists deals from nationwide retail stores along with a description and a list price which enables you to know how much of a deal the store is offering. The site has some cool features which include coupons, a price comparison tool and a hot deal email alert you can sign up to receive.


AbleShoppers lists deals by date. New items are added daily. They also offer online coupons, shopping tips and a newsletter you can sign up to receive. Shopping with coupons, especially at the grocery store can save you as much as 75% off your grocery bill.


It may be annoying standing in line behind someone in the grocery store with a pocket full of coupons but after you see how they save you can surely see it is worth the time.

Just about every item you purchase can and will go on sale.


Wait for the rock bottom prices for big items like electronics. Check out the price comparison websites like:

  • Pricegrabber.com

  • BizRate.com

  • Shopping.com

  • Google's price comparison - If you have a specific item in mind, know the make and model you want, price comparison shopping search engine may help you out.


Searching this site will bring you many results to choose from along with product reviews, seller ratings and where you can locate the item in your area.
